A leading hospitality provider in Edinburgh seeks a Front of House Catering & Hospitality Supervisor to ensure excellent service in a vibrant environment. The ideal candidate will have strong hospitality experience and leadership skills, managing a team and events while ensuring customer satisfaction.

Offering competitive pay, regular weekday hours, and various benefits, this role provides a balanced work-life opportunity within a prestigious school environ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Sodexo Ltd

Know Your Hospitality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your hospitality knowledge. Understand the latest trends in catering and service excellence, as well as any specific practices that the company values. This will show that you're not just experienced but also genuinely interested in the role.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ed a team in the past. Think about challenges you've faced and how you motivated your team to deliver exceptional service. This is your chance to demonstrate your leadership style and how it aligns with the company's values.

Customer Satisfaction is Key

Be ready to discuss how you ensure customer satisfaction in your previous roles. Share specific instances where you went above and beyond for guests or resolved issues effectively. This will highlight your commitment to providing an excellent experience.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ions to ask at the end of your interview. Inquire about the team dynamics, upcoming events, or how they measure success in this role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
